Output efad1c2f659d114f2a49cf4f1a8cf20da7b0e7686d6a54cbe9f124af6b1225d5:2

value
23066000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c321ceb8ace1e8dbf5cd1f446c7aa920778088b OP_EQUAL
address
3A6W86tM24yYT8EYtasL5QCYnpfFrmwVzr
transaction
efad1c2f659d114f2a49cf4f1a8cf20da7b0e7686d6a54cbe9f124af6b1225d5
confirmations
430077
spent
true